The Vacancy

We have an opportunity for a Scheduler to join our Wates team within our Responsive Maintenance division. You will be working out of our Ealing office on one of our social housing contracts, delivering planning for our reactive maintenance appointments.

Key Accountabilities will include:

  1. Schedule works into diaries for up to 20 operatives daily ensuring diaries are full and immediate attention is given to allocate work to operatives when they become free.
  2. Check the system for emergencies and manage within a timely manner to ensure targets are met.
  3. Respond to telephone variations by seeking approval from duty surveyor so operatives may continue on the site through to completion.
  4. Provide a high-quality service to our client on a face-to-face basis.
  5. Work within a team to achieve goals and targets, achieving daily targets of a minimum of 60 allocations each day of new orders.

Work for Wates

Wates is one of the UK's leading family-owned development, building and property maintenance companies. Founded over 125 years ago, we have a proud legacy in the built environment.

We are driven by our purpose, 'reimagining places for people to thrive' and our three promises:

Thriving places - working with customers, partners, and communities to create places that are more sustainable, inclusive, and full of opportunity.
Thriving planet - protecting nature and taking action on climate change by collaborating and innovating with our partners.
Thriving people - creating opportunities and relationships so that everyone who works for and with us feels included, invested in, and treated with care.
